Job SummaryWe are seeking a Water Engineer to join our Water Sector team in the Greater Toronto Area.
Make waves with a collaborative and creative team as you work on a variety of municipal infrastructure projects; provide mentoring and direction to junior engineers and designers; build and maintain client relationships, and hone your technical and leadership skills.
Responsibilities & QualificationsDU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:- Build and maintain key customer relationships and assist with increasing current market position. Support proposal process.
- Manage and actively participate in projects.
- Provide direction to the design teams throughout all phases of a project. Review drawings and engineering reports.
- Liaise with the various municipal/utility/approval agencies.
- Responsible for the financial management project, project schedules, and client communications.
- Participate in company-wide quality initiatives and improvements through quality objectives such as facilitating departmental-level quality plans and procedures.
- Mentor intermediate team members.
- Additional responsibilities as assigned.
QUALIFICATIONS (INCLUDING EDUCATION and/or JOB EXPERIENCE): - Professional Engineer (P. Eng.).
- 5-10+ years of municipal infrastructure design for Public Sector projects in Southern Ontario & Canada.
- Familiarity with local planning/approval process.
- PMP Certification is a preferred asset.
